Specifications
Series: --
Packaging: Tube 
Part Status: Not For New Designs
Mode: Average Current
Frequency - Switching: 65kHz
Current - Startup: 1.3mA
Voltage - Supply: 11 V ~ 25 V
Operating Temperature: -40°C ~ 150°C
Mounting Type: Through Hole
Package / Case: 16-DIP (0.300", 7.62mm)
Supplier Device Package: PG-DIP-16
Base Part Number: ICE1CS02
